Parenting strategies for children with mental health issues involve specific techniques and approaches to help support the well-being and development of children who are facing mental health challenges.

Key Features

  • Creating a safe and supportive environment
  • Building a strong relationship with the child
  • Implementing effective communication strategies
  • Accessing appropriate professional support and resources

Pros

  • Helps parents better understand and support their child's mental health needs
  • Can improve the overall well-being and functioning of the child
  • Encourages open communication and collaboration between parents, children, and mental health professionals

Cons

  • May require significant time, effort, and resources to implement effectively
  • Can be challenging to navigate the complex landscape of mental health services and treatments
